CARY, N.C. – The Gardner-Webb men's and women's cross country teams set two new personal records as the teams competed in the Adidas XC Challenge at the WakeMed Soccer Park Cross Country Course in Cary, N.C. on Friday evening.
Mitchell Brown was the first GWU runner to complete the men's 6K course, clocking in at 20:09.2 in his first race for the Runnin' Bulldogs at that distance.
Keaton Poole followed with a time of 20:16.5.
Josh Parks set a new personal record with a time of 21:09.8, while
Ezekiel Martin also set a new PR, clocking in at 21:31.8.
Newcomers
Bogdan Podgaisky and
Sam Hermanns finished with times of 24:24.1 and 28:23.0 respectively.
On the women's side,
Gabby Cortese finished the 5K course with a time of 19:43.8. She was followed by
Sydney Davis, who clocked in at 21:34.7.
Hannah Jones clocked in with a time of 22:13.2, with
Michaela Williams (22:24.1) and
Rachel White (22:29.6) following close behind.
Logan McGuirt rounded out the field of GWU runners with a time of 22:34.6.
Gardner-Webb returns to action on Saturday, September 23 as the Runnin' Bulldogs take part in the Asheville Cross Country Invitational, hosted by UNC Asheville at the Asheville Christian Academy. The meet is set for a 9:00 am start time.
